I updated my apt sources to point to the Jaunty do-core PPA on launchpad late last week so that I could play with the new docklets. I've noticed two things about the changes (version 0.8.2):
* Do takes a larger initial memory footprint than in previous versions (now uses ~2% of available when starting; used to be < 1%) * There's an apparent memory leak. I did not restart Do for around 72 hours, and in that time it went from using ~2% of available memory to using around 40%. At the time, I had only the clock, trash, and weather docklets enabled.
